Thursday, January 15, 2009. Winter Blues and Foods/Recipes. Wintertime can wreak havoc on your sleeping cycle. Dwindling hours of light, which reach a peak at the winter solstice on Dec. 21, can alter the body's circadian rhythm. Disrupted sleep patterns can lead to irritability and anxiety, which is why it's important to maintain a regular sleep schedule if possible. Saturday, May 23, 2009. SUBVERSIVE STITCHING: Feminist Artists with a Needle. Organized by Through the Flower. Juried by Artist Judy Chicago and Laura Addison, Curator of Contemporary Art, New Mexico Museum of Art. Call for art in all needlework and textile media from artists' who reside in New Mexico. Works submitted should include a focus on gender. One winner will be awarded a $500 cash prize. Entry deadline: October 16, 2009. Notice of inclusion: November 20, 2009. January 23, 2010 - May 31, 2010.
